The quote describes a character with delicate, attractive features that are accompanied by a subtle, cautious smile. This suggests that the character may be aware of their surroundings and possibly guarded in their interactions with others. The use of "polite wariness" indicates a blend of charm and underlying vigilance, hinting at a complexity in their personality.
This portrayal, drawn from Jim Thompson's novella "The Alcoholics," evokes a sense of intrigue about the character's emotions and experiences. The smile might be a defense mechanism, suggesting they navigate social situations with both grace and caution. Overall, the quote paints a vivid picture of a person caught between vulnerability and self-protection.
